ArcBest's RSI of 74.6 signals deeply overbought territory, yet the P/E of 50.16 suggests the market is pricing in substantial future growth. The stock trades well below its 52-week high despite extreme momentum readings, creating an interesting disconnect—either the recent rally has room to run or mean reversion looms. With only 7.74% short interest, there's minimal squeeze risk cushioning any pullback. The trucking sector's cyclical nature makes this valuation particularly precarious; if freight demand softens, the multiple could compress sharply. Current technicals indicate exhaustion risk even as fundamentals may justify the elevated earnings multiple.
